Find the perimeter of the triangle whose vertices are the following, specified points in the plane.
hichkok12 [17]

Given:

The vertices of the triangle are (-10,-3), (1,4) and (-1,7).

To find:

The perimeter of the triangle.

Solution:

Distance formula:

d=\sqrt{(x_2-x_1)^2+(y_2-y_1)^2}

Let the vertices of the triangle are A(-10,-3), B(1,4) and C(-1,7).

Using distance formula, we get

AB=\sqrt{(1-(-10))^2+(4-(-3))^2}

AB=\sqrt{(1+10)^2+(4+3)^2}

AB=\sqrt{(11)^2+(7)^2}

AB=\sqrt{121+49}

AB=\sqrt{170}

Similarly,

BC=\sqrt{\left(-1-1\right)^2+\left(7-4\right)^2}=\sqrt{13}

AC=\sqrt{\left(-1-\left(-10\right)\right)^2+\left(7-\left(-3\right)\right)^2} =\sqrt{181}

Now, the perimeter of the triangle is

Perimeter=AB+BC+AC

Perimeter=\sqrt{170}+\sqrt{13}+\sqrt{181}

Perimeter\approx 13.038+3.606+13.454

Perimeter=30.098

Therefore, the perimeter of the triangle is 30.098 units.
